Wanderer in the Wilderness
quilts by Dianne Finnegan
November 5th – 28th 2009

Dianne Finnegan’s quilts are autobiographical. She attended Wilderness School and lived in Canada for a couple of years and these facts influenced her choice of a title for her current exhibition, Wanderer in the Wilderness, which is the Canadian name for a quilt design more commonly known as Drunkard’s Path.

She has recently been using the textiles she has gathered from around the world over many years to create quilts that would work equally on the wall as on the bed. A wander through the exhibition would take the viewer past Japanese shibori dyed and stencilled indigos, Indonesian batiks, Nigerian batiks and hand dyed fabrics that evoke the deserts of Central Australia. The visual texture of the textiles is exploited when it is cut and recombined with other fabrics to create a fresh vision. Traditional patterns are reinterpreted and original designs developed.

Most of our important life events occur in the bed, surely it deserves a worthy cover? Moving from the horizontal to the vertical, a quilt on the wall provides a striking graphic as well as acoustic benefits.
